What do the legal guidelines say?

Within the Champions League, the VAR will solely test for clear and apparent errors regarding objectives, incidents within the penalty space, direct purple playing cards and circumstances of mistaken id.

At current, it is not going to intervene on yellow playing cards – so downgrading Kelly’s preliminary dismissal for a second bookable offence was by no means VAR’s intention.

Nonetheless, the ideas above apply solely when VAR is deciding to ship the referee to the monitor. As soon as the match official begins the overview, they’re in cost and may take no matter choice they deem acceptable.

Kelly was as an alternative proven a straight purple for being deemed to have dedicated a critical foul after he landed on the again of Yilmaz’s Achilles following an aerial problem with the ahead.

So was it the right choice?

Former Premier League defender Curtis Davies mentioned the choice was an “absolute shame”.

“Kelly goes up for a header, he is gone for the header cleanly. His toes should land on the bottom someplace,” he added on BBC Radio 5 Dwell.

“Sadly, he lands on the participant. There must be a stage of understanding – the place is he meant to place his toes? I perceive Kelly’s frustration.”
